    As far as the shad issue. You don't see near as many shad in Patoka, Boggs and other lakes up here as you do in more southern impoundments so I really don't think the shad are that big of issue. Also, everyone assumes that someone released the fish there. I know several small lakes/ponds in KY that have never had any shad put in them yet they are there. As mentioned before it you have a crane or any other water bird land in a shad bearing lake and they step into a shad next full of eggs then fly to another body of water these eggs are moved via their feet and legs not to mention what they eat. I've talked to several biologist outside of Indiana (no faith in INDNR)and they all say that this is possible and highly feasible.
